Group classes at Adapt Health and Performance are small, coach-led sessions programmed around strength and conditioning principles. Class sizes are kept limited so the coach can still see and correct every participant. Sessions run from the North Sydney studio at Shop 2/66 Clark Road across weekday mornings, evenings, and Saturdays.

Pricing

How much does group classes at Adapt cost?

Indicative pricing below. Confirm the current fee for your selected appointment when you book.

OptionPriceDuration
Casual classfrom $4545 to 60 min
10-class packfrom $40045 to 60 min each
Unlimited monthlyfrom $320per month
